  7. Only played two games but it's certainly different.

    Pressing feels a bit odd, even though my mentality is positive and I have high line and high engagement, after a short oppo goal kick things go weird, the d line stays put and I only get one midfielder run out about 100 miles and try to press. It may be the player roles etc, but it seems weird, sometimes everything sort of stops while opposition have the ball in their half after a goal kick.

    Liking the wide play, no longer does it seem that a player will stop and wait to be closed down to kick it into the shins and out for a corner. No more short corners played back to the taker for an offside.

    Balls over the top seem to have gone right down, had 1 clear one on one in 2 matches and that came from a surging run, not a through ball. It was saved by the keeper but it seemed plausible taking into mind the angle , speed of the run, etc. Goalmouth action does seem a little more realistic. 

    The game still doesn't flow as I'd like, but I think the engine is a decent step in the right direction.
